## Local setup

The N+1 fix in Graphlet batches resolver loads via the new DataHatch loader. To reproduce the old behavior, set `BATCHING=off`. Run `make seed` to load fixture authors/posts, then `make bench` to compare query counts — expect 3 queries, not 200. Seeding requires a local Postgres reachable via the string below.

replica DSN, kajep-yahag: mssql://praok_svc:iF@db-8d68.plorvaio.local:5432/eliion

Internal Memo — Training Budget FY Next

To the finance team: the proposed training budget for next year holds steady at this year's level, with a modest reallocation toward systems training for the new Ledgerpoint rollout. Departmental requests are due by month-end; anything above allocation needs sign-off from Director Hale. Approved figures feed into the January plan. The confidential note on related business plans appears immediately below.

internal memo for yahag-tahog: The pricing group signed off on a budget of $152.8 million for Project Soriel.

Ticket: Staging env misconfigured for Siftgate bloom filter

The bloom layer in front of the Pellet KV store is rejecting all lookups in staging because the env file was copied from the dev template without credentials. False-positive tuning values are fine; only the auth line is missing. To unblock the weekly demo, the Pellet admission secret must be set on the following line.

env line for yaguf-fajop: LEDGER_TOKEN13=fb08984397349